diff --git a/examples/textures_mipmaps.c b/examples/textures_mipmaps.c deleted file mode 100644 index 6b7a64f0..00000000 --- a/examples/textures_mipmaps.c +++ /dev/null @@ -1,66 +0,0 @@ -/******************************************************************************************* -* -* raylib [textures] example - Texture loading with mipmaps, mipmaps generation -* -* NOTE: On OpenGL 1.1, mipmaps are calculated 'manually', original image must be power-of-two -* On OpenGL 3.3 and ES2, mipmaps are generated automatically -* -* This example has been created using raylib 1.1 (www.raylib.com) -* raylib is licensed under an unmodified zlib/libpng license (View raylib.h for details) -* -* Copyright (c) 2014 Ramon Santamaria (Ray San - raysan@raysanweb.com) -* -********************************************************************************************/ - -#include "raylib.h" - -int main() -{ - // Initialization - //-------------------------------------------------------------------------------------- - int screenWidth = 800; - int screenHeight = 450; - - InitWindow(screenWidth, screenHeight, "raylib [textures] example - texture mipmaps generation"); - - // NOTE: To generate mipmaps for an image, image must be loaded first and converted to texture - - Image image = LoadImage("resources/raylib_logo.png"); // Load image to CPU memory (RAM) - Texture2D texture = LoadTextureFromImage(image); // Load texture into GPU memory (VRAM) - GenTextureMipmaps(texture); // Generate mipmaps for texture - - UnloadImage(image); // Once texture has been created, we can unload image data from RAM - //-------------------------------------------------------------------------------------- - - // Main game loop - while (!WindowShouldClose()) // Detect window close button or ESC key - { - // Update - //---------------------------------------------------------------------------------- - // TODO: Update your variables here - //---------------------------------------------------------------------------------- - - // Draw - //---------------------------------------------------------------------------------- - BeginDrawing(); - - ClearBackground(RAYWHITE); - - DrawTexture(texture, screenWidth/2 - texture.width/2, - screenHeight/2 - texture.height/2 - 30, WHITE); - - DrawText("this IS a texture with mipmaps! really!", 210, 360, 20, GRAY); - - EndDrawing(); - //---------------------------------------------------------------------------------- - } - - // De-Initialization - //-------------------------------------------------------------------------------------- - UnloadTexture(texture); // Texture unloading - - CloseWindow(); // Close window and OpenGL context - //-------------------------------------------------------------------------------------- - - return 0; -}
